Frozen pipe repair services involve addressing pipes that have become damaged or burst due to freezing temperatures. When temperatures drop, water inside pipes can freeze, expand, and exert pressure on the pipe walls, leading to cracks or complete ruptures. Repair specialists focus on locating the affected pipes, removing the ice blockage, and restoring the pipe’s integrity. In some cases, repairs may include replacing sections of damaged pipe or applying specialized insulation to prevent future freezing issues. Proper repair techniques are essential to minimize water damage and restore plumbing functionality efficiently.
This service helps resolve common problems associated with frozen pipes, such as water supply interruptions, leaks, and flooding. When pipes burst, they can cause significant water damage to walls, floors, and personal property. Repair professionals also address issues like slow leaks or cracks that may not be immediately visible but can worsen over time. Prompt repairs help prevent further damage, reduce repair costs, and restore normal water flow. Repair Cost Range - The typical cost for frozen pipe repair can vary from $150 to $600 depending on the extent of the damage and accessibility. Simple repairs might be closer to the lower end, while more extensive work can approach the higher end.
Factors Influencing Cost - Costs are influenced by pipe location, pipe material, and whether additional repairs are needed. For example, replacing a section of pipe in a basement may cost around $200 to $400.
Additional Expenses - Emergency repairs or repairs during off-hours may incur additional charges, often adding $50 to $150 to the base cost. The total expense depends on the specific situation and contractor rates.
Cost Estimates for Service Providers - Local service providers typically offer estimates that range from $100 to $700 for frozen pipe repairs, with prices varying based on the complexity and scope of work involved.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es pipes to freeze? Pipes can freeze due to prolonged exposure to cold temperatures, especially when insulation is inadequate or during sudden cold snaps in Wasatch County and nearby areas.
How can I tell if a pipe is frozen? Signs include lack of water flow, visible frost on pipes, or a pipe feeling cold to the touch. If a pipe has burst, there may be water leakage or water damage signs.
Are frozen pipes likely to burst? Yes, when water inside pipes freezes and expands, it can cause the pipe to crack or burst, leading to potential water damage.
What should I do if I suspect a frozen pipe? Contact local plumbing or repair specialists to assess and safely thaw the pipe, preventing further damage or bursting.
Can frozen pipes be prevented? Proper insulation, sealing leaks, and maintaining consistent indoor temperatures can help prevent pipes from freezing in colder months.
